emacs-diffs
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

master 57eb0db: Avoid making backup files in ediff when `make-backup-fil


From: Lars Ingebrigtsen
Subject: master 57eb0db: Avoid making backup files in ediff when `make-backup-files' is nil
Date: Thu, 8 Jul 2021 09:46:55 -0400 (EDT)

branch: master
commit 57eb0db9dc270278db9d51214fae780f020fef6a
Author: Lars Ingebrigtsen <larsi@gnus.org>
Commit: Lars Ingebrigtsen <larsi@gnus.org>

    Avoid making backup files in ediff when `make-backup-files' is nil
    
    * lisp/vc/ediff-util.el (ediff-arrange-autosave-in-merge-jobs):
    Don't make backup files when `make-backup-files' is nil (bug#21599).
---
 lisp/vc/ediff-util.el | 5 +++--
 1 file changed, 3 insertions(+), 2 deletions(-)

diff --git a/lisp/vc/ediff-util.el b/lisp/vc/ediff-util.el
index b2b92b1..0cbea2c 100644
--- a/lisp/vc/ediff-util.el
+++ b/lisp/vc/ediff-util.el
@@ -563,8 +563,9 @@ to invocation.")
            (set-visited-file-name merge-buffer-file))))
     (ediff-with-current-buffer ediff-buffer-C
       (setq buffer-offer-save t) ; ask before killing buffer
-      ;; make sure the contents is auto-saved
-      (auto-save-mode 1))
+      (when make-backup-files
+        ;; make sure the contents is auto-saved
+        (auto-save-mode 1)))
     ))
 
 



reply via email to

[Prev in Thread] Current Thread [Next in Thread]